Winter Pruning
Winter is an ideal time to prune, as the lack of leaves on deciduous trees and shrubs enables you to see what you’re doing. As the trees are dormant cuts are less likely to bleed and will quickly callous over before growth begins again in Spring. Pruning Soft Fruit Bushes
Pruning helps maintain the balance between wood and fruit as it causes dormant buds in the old wood to produce growth that will become the next fruiting wood. Getting rid of old unproductive branches is vital for disease control and to improve air circulation. It also makes fruit picking easier! Keep all blades oiled, sharp and clean.
